age-0.0.1.0: test/Test/Crypto/Age/Key/Gen.hs
module Test.Crypto.Age.Key.Gen
( genFileKey
, genPayloadKeyNonce
, genPayloadKey
) where
import Crypto.Age.Key
( FileKey
, PayloadKey
, PayloadKeyNonce
, bytesToFileKey
, bytesToPayloadKey
, bytesToPayloadKeyNonce
)
import Hedgehog ( Gen )
import qualified Hedgehog.Gen as Gen
import qualified Hedgehog.Range as Range
import Prelude
import Test.Gen ( genByteArray )
genFileKey :: Gen FileKey
genFileKey = do
bs <- genByteArray (Range.singleton 16)
case bytesToFileKey bs of
Nothing -> fail "failed to generate a FileKey"
Just x -> pure x
genPayloadKeyNonce :: Gen PayloadKeyNonce
genPayloadKeyNonce = do
bs <- Gen.bytes (Range.singleton 16)
case bytesToPayloadKeyNonce bs of
Nothing -> fail "failed to generate a PayloadKeyNonce"
Just x -> pure x
genPayloadKey :: Gen PayloadKey
genPayloadKey = do
bs <- genByteArray (Range.singleton 32)
case bytesToPayloadKey bs of
Nothing -> fail "failed to generate a PayloadKey"
Just x -> pure x
